ORIGINAL: nanaki

meh.. i don't think LTs are really worth the price vs performance. unless you can put them in yourself.
+1

LTs require a custom mide pipe, and the brand options for those midpipes are limited. Unless you want to change out the whole exhaust, a pair of ceramic coated shorties will get you what you need. Just make sure to put lock washers on each of the bolts to keep them from backing out and blowing header gaskets.
